**Checklist — Gatecount rollout**

Quick one for the sync: the Brindlemoor Arena turnstile counter now debounces double-taps, so the phantom-entry spikes from last season should be gone. Verify counts against the manual tally during Friday's test event before we flip it stadium-wide. Sign-off goes in the tracker as usual. Token for the staged build is below.

pipeline stamp: htk31_f769b577b3028a4e9958e5bb8d1259a

TURN-208: Gatevale turnstile counters at the Merrow Field pilot double-count when a rotation reverses mid-cycle. Attendance totals drift roughly 2% high per event. The debounce window fix is implemented, reviewed by Ilsa, and soak-tested across two simulated match days without drift. Ready for your cut; the candidate build is identified below.

trace token, tagag-tafog: htk6_5ed18c

**Onboarding: Payroll export v2 (Tallyridge)**

As of this quarter, Tallyridge emits payroll exports in the v2 columnar format; the legacy CSV path is removed. If the nightly export fails, check the formatter pod first, then the upload stage. The uploader signs each batch with a credential, which the .env file sets on the following line.

secret setting of bajeg-yahog: LEDGER_TOKEN20=f833f3e2e6625ec0dee3